Web30 okt. 2024 · A demising wall is, simply put, a divider wall that exists to separate a pair of residences, commercial buildings, or sometimes even a residence and a commercial building. These walls are sometimes structural and sometimes non-structural. Think, for example, of an apartment building. Web12 apr. 2012 · With heat detectors this figure is 7.5m x 7.5m, giving an area of coverage of 56m² per device which is rounded down to 50m². BS 5839 states that detectors should be sited no less than 0.5m from a wall. Any obstruction which is less than 300mm from the ceiling should be treated as a wall, thus requiring a detector either side of the obstruction.
